I have vista (though upgrading to Win7, woot!), and I was getting a lot of issues running Half-life, too.

One thing you might want to try is turning off Data Execution Prevention (DEP) for the game. Go into System - Advanced System Settings, then, in the advanced tab, click “settings” for “performance”. Go to the data execution prevention tab, and add C:\Program Files\Steam\steamapps\ACCOUNT NAME HERE\half-life\hl.exe to the list of exceptions.

It worked for me. Still, Vista is a pain in the ass with all these compatibility issues, that’s one of the reasons I’m upgrading.
